Union Minister assures cheap drinking water, tea and snacks at airports

New Delhi, Mar 28 (UNI) All airports in the country will soon have facilities like drinking water, tea, coffee, and snacks at reasonable rates, Union Civil Aviation Minister K Ramamohana Naidu said on Friday.
Taking part in a debate on a private resolution headlined "Appropriate measures for regulation of air travel fares" in the Lok Sabha, the minister responded to members' concerns over drinking water being very expensive at airports.
Naidu said a system has been laid out to provide drinking water at cheap rates at airports.
